I just received such one and have it run in a leefbody 2 18650 setup.
nice and bright, a tiny bit on the blue side
draws ~ 0.5 A from the batts

slightly smaller hotspot than a Cree with a McR-XR 19 mm, wider spill

with very short distance from the wall, slight cree rings noticeable (as with any reflector that leaves the cree metal ring exposed), but from a distance of 2 meters from the wall on, no longer noticeable.
imho a very good part.
(dont get that "5-Mode" one, it sucks bad)

Received my sku 6090 from DX couple of days ago and find the beam pattern too ringy for my tastes. To counter that, I unscrewed the LE from the reflector, inserted an o-ring cut down to size and placed into the base of the reflector. This resulted in the Cree sitting deeper into the reflector and the rings are now almost unnoticeable 2 feet from the wall. The only downside is now there is a 1mm gap between the bezel and the body of my 6P, but I can live with that - for now. I might pare down the reflector a bit to get rid of the gap later.

Oh, it's brighter, whiter and with larger hotspot when compared to another another cree drop-in that I got earlier (from Calvin Mo). Save for the initial ringy beam, overall not bad for a $10 drop-in.
